Preheat your oven to 180Β°C (350Β°F).
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the mushrooms and cook until they are golden brown, about 5-7 minutes. Stir occasionally.
Finely chop the garlic and add it to the skillet with the mushrooms, cooking for an additional 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Add the spinach leaves to the skillet and cook until wilted, about 2 minutes. Remove the skillet from the heat and set aside.
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, heavy cream, and softened cream cheese until smooth and well combined.
Stir in the salt, pepper, and grated Parmesan cheese into the egg mixture.
Gently fold the cooked mushrooms, garlic, and spinach into the egg mixture. Ensure that everything is evenly distributed.
Pour the mixture into a greased 9-inch pie or quiche dish.
Place the quiche dish in the oven and bake for 30-35 minutes, or until the quiche is set and the top is lightly golden.
Remove the quiche from the oven and allow it to cool for a few minutes before slicing.
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
